Transaction 63a65c4958d65153bdf5d0c2c7d1697c6d0e421ca9335f0141e4d67a77420088

2 Input
2 Outputs
  • 63a65c4958d65153bdf5d0c2c7d1697c6d0e421ca9335f0141e4d67a77420088:0
  • value  50000000
    address  32HgxLMA71LFEZriXE5fQuuuob2KCEzwtq
  • 63a65c4958d65153bdf5d0c2c7d1697c6d0e421ca9335f0141e4d67a77420088:1
  • value  7984683
    address  3LZutM8GA2iyMFosoVpqSoZvB6Qm4TiurA